   Hey ladies,
I have brought some internet cheapie PG tests (I can't even remember where from I thought they were David brand but not even sure on that...) my issue though is that everyone on the packet is in chinese!!
 I wasn't too concerned how hard is it right, dip it - 2 lines = BFP, however don't know what the 'developing' time is - is it usually within 2 mins?
 
 Thanks in advance!

   Hiya Monkeys    Firstly.... my lines came up clearer on my ICs than on my first response.... I'm a convert!!!!!
 You dip it in for min of 10 seconds, I usually do till pink is almost at the top....
 Results come within 2-5mins..... if no line after 10 mins then it's a negative....
